Linux behöver en plattform för att lyckas, det är vad Tobias Bernard tror 

Linux-skrivbord

tobias bernard, är en Gnome-designer som arbetar för Purism för att få miljön på företagets mobila enheter, "Librem 5" kommenterar att det verkliga Linux-problemet Saken är den, Till skillnad från Windows och macOS finns det verkligen ingen Linux-plattform.

Linux är det största samhällsprojektet i utvecklingsvärlden och trots detta fortsätter vi att lyssna den berömda frasen, "I år är Linuxåret" i princip som att säga att "det här året är det goda", men detta händer inte. Linux, så mycket som det integrerar innovationer, fortsätter att misslyckas på skrivbordet och även om flera har försökt förklara detta för många problem, inklusive bristen på tillverkare som erbjuder förinstallerade Linux-datorer, stöd för egen programvara och drivrutiner, användargränssnitt som människor ibland tycker är mycket grundläggande eller problemet med fragmentering av ekosystemet.

Trots detta många ansträngningar har gjorts för att förbättra ekosystemet på Linux mer och mer, sedan tidigare ett av de stora problemen på grund av fragmentering var ansökningarna, Tja, även detta föreslog ett problem för utvecklare eftersom de erbjöd sin applikation genom kompileringsalternativet för att undvika att behöva investera mer tid i skapandet av specifika paket för de olika Linux-distributionerna eller i grund och botten investerade de den tiden där båda fallen var en del av problem.

Även om detta har förändrats över tid och ankomsten av universella applikationer för Linux, säg "Flatpak", "Snap" eller AppImage, för Tobias Bernard löser detta inte roten till problem.

Nåväl säger han:

”Jag tror att kärnan i saken faktiskt är det nedre lagret: innan vi kan ha friska ekosystem behöver vi friska plattformar för att bygga dem.

För honom, framgångsrika plattformar kännetecknas av olika element som lätt kan gå förlorade bara genom att titta på ytan.

plattform-delar-1

På utvecklarsidan, till exempel, de har ett operativsystem att utvecklare kan användas för att bygga applikationer och erbjuda en SDK och verktyg inbyggt i operativsystemet.

också behöver dokumentation från utvecklaren, handledning, etc. så att människor kan lära sig att utvecklas för plattformen. Och när apparna har skapats måste det finnas en appbutik för att skicka dem.

Men jagUtvecklare kan inte bygga bra appar själv. Med det sagt, du behöver också designers. Och designers behöver verktyg för att simulera och prototypa applikationer, användargränssnittsmallar för saker som layout och navigering.

På slutanvändarsidan, Tobias Bernard förklarar det behöver ett operativsystem för konsumenten med en integrerad appbutik, där människor kan få appar som skapats av utvecklare.

Huvudoperativsystemet kan vara detsamma som utvecklarens operativsystem, men inte nödvändigtvis (till exempel är detta inte fallet för Android eller iOS).

Användare de måste också ha ett sätt att få hjälp eller stöd när de har problem med sitt system (vare sig det är fysiska butiker, en hjälpwebbplats eller vad som helst).

Med andra ord, Tobias Bernard anser att du inte kan prata om en plattform innan du träffas fyra väsentliga villkor: ett operativsystem, en utvecklarplattform, ett designspråk och en appbutik.

Linux, nej, eftersom Linux är en kärna, som kan användas för att skapa operativsystem kring vilka plattformar kan byggas, som Google har gjort med Android. Men en kärna ensam uppfyller inte alla fyra villkoren och är därför inte en plattform.

Ubuntu är ännu inte en plattform, eftersom har inte de mest kritiska elementen, dvs en SDK eller en teknikstack för utvecklare och ett designspråk. Andra distributioner är i en liknande situation som Ubuntu, men värre eftersom de inte har appbutiker.

Medan det gäller Gnome kommenterar han att det är en stationär stack mest populär i den fria programvaruvärlden och har ett SDK och ett designspråk. Det har dock inget operativsystem. Många distributioner kommer med GNOME, men de är alla olika på ett eller annat sätt, så de ger inte ett enhetligt utvecklingsmål.

Fuente: https://blogs.gnome.org/


Lämna din kommentar

Din e-postadress kommer inte att publiceras. Obligatoriska fält är markerade med *

*

*

  1. Ansvarig för data: AB Internet Networks 2008 SL
  2. Syftet med uppgifterna: Kontrollera skräppost, kommentarhantering.
  3. Legitimering: Ditt samtycke
  4. Kommunikation av uppgifterna: Uppgifterna kommer inte att kommuniceras till tredje part förutom enligt laglig skyldighet.
  5. Datalagring: databas värd för Occentus Networks (EU)
  6. Rättigheter: När som helst kan du begränsa, återställa och radera din information.

  1.   anonym sade

    GNU är inte ett företag! därför är ditt slut inte pengar ... sluta jämföra bacon med hastighet. GNU finns där som ett samhällsprojekt för socialt gott, som görs av samhället för samhället i form av ett gemensamt nytta.
    Eftersom så mycket iver att vilja erövra människor är GNU där för den som vill ha det, om de inte gör det
    för det ser inte ut som vad du använder ... mycket bra, fortsätt använda det du har använt och hacka i evigheter. Men när jag försöker nedgradera GNU så att den liknar den piratkopierade ägaren de använder för att få dem att komma, tror jag är den dumma stora bokstaven ... GNU är exakt kraftfull och överlägsen eftersom den inte är som de andra ägarna.
    Men från gnome är det tydligare än vatten ... eftersom de blev beroende av systemd, är allt sagt.

  2.   linuxlachupa sade

    Linux suger det, Windows!

    1.    Pepe sade

      +1

  3.   Miguel sade

    Vilken skillnad spelar skrivbordet, om det är nästan irrelevant?

    99% GNU-servrar
    Mobil 99% kärna POSIX, FreeBSD + Linux
    80% eller mer Linux
    Chrome OS (Linux) bärbara datorer äter marknaden i USA

    Och MS WOS lägger till LiGNUx-terminalstöd

    I Kina och Ryssland har de redan beslutat att MIGRERA hela administrationen till LiGNUx DESKS

    Huawei säljer redan miljontals bärbara datorer med Deepin LiGNUx förinstallerat.

    När Huawei säljer sina bärbara datorer med Deepin LiGNUx förinstallerat i väst, kommer det förutom Kina och Indien (eller något liknande) att bli året för LiGNUx-skrivbordet.

    Och det är mycket närmare än vi tror.

    1.    linuxlachupa sade

      Inte precis skrivbordet, utan att vara en datavetare eller en fri programvaruentusiast, skapar okunnigheten och för min del "överberoendet av linux" med dess olika "smaker" en slags bubbla av överväldigande när man bestämmer en distribution med skrivbordet .

      Förutom att vara inom olika områden, WEB, NÄTVERK, KONTOR och till och med spel, har det genererat stort intresse hos slutkundens "användare eller konsument" men problemet ligger just i dess drift "ett verktyg".

      Dess popularitet växer men det finns ingen distribuerad konsumentvänlig distro som är tillräckligt attraktiv för någon att se en linux-enhet bredvid en Windows-enhet och säga, okej, det här är bättre på något som konsumenten letar efter, "säkerhet, effektivitet och lågt pris» .

      Det bästa exemplet är android, men dess begränsningar på mobila enheter blir allt mindre, jag tror att android i framtiden kommer att utvecklas till en massiv distro som konkurrerar med windows, men inte som en sekundär distro utan som något kanoniskt.

      1.    David naranjo sade

        Jag håller med, på grund av den fragmentering som Linux har är det svårt att lägga grunden för att skapa en enhetlig plattform.
        Även om Linux är den centrala delen, eftersom fri programvara låter dig ta källkoden för ett program, Linux distro eller något projekt som distribueras under dessa villkor, kommer en person eller organisation förr eller senare att ta koden. Ändra antingen minimalt eller kraftigt och detta fortsätter att passera som en sträng.
        Vad ska jag göra med det, för jag kommer att ta ett exempel på Debians fall då de bestämde sig för att anta systemd ... Detta genererade missnöje som delade upp samhället där de i grunden var pro systemd och anti systemd, vilket genererade att den senare väljer att fortsätta med sin vision om en Debian utan systemd vilket ledde till skapandet av Devuan.
        Ett annat exempel, gnome när jag gjorde övergången från Gnome 2 till Gnome 3, många missnöje och slutade i andra projekt som skulle ta grunden till Gnome 2 och förkroppsligades i Mate.
        Slutligen ett exempel där idén om "Jag gillar ditt projekt, men jag vill ha min egen version av er" gäller, vi har Ubuntu som härrör från Debian eller fallet med Deepin som som många kommer att veta är ett OS utvecklat i Kina .
        Fram till den dag då alla sätter sig ner och säger "ok, låt oss arbeta tillsammans för att förena Linux", fallet med Linux som segrar på skrivbordet kommer knappast att hända.

      2.    Marlon sade

        Enligt min mening saknar Linux det att det kan användas utan någon extra Office-applikation.

    2.    David naranjo sade

      Linux har utan tvekan nått poäng som andra knappast kunde uppnå, så är fallet på servrar eftersom det praktiskt taget dominerar marknaden.
      I mobil (ur personlig synvinkel) lyckas det eftersom många företag kan anpassa det utan att behöva investera i forskning och utveckling för ett nytt operativsystem, låt oss ta fallet med Firefox OS som slutade med misslyckande eftersom Android och till och med iOS De är inte dagens system eller för 5 år sedan, de har gått igenom många år av ständig utveckling för att vara där de är nu. Firefox misslyckades eftersom det inte hade de grundläggande applikationerna som vanligtvis lockar en gemensam användare, som är sociala nätverk, webbläsare, snabbmeddelanden.

      Så är fallet med bilsystem, få företag är engagerade i intern utveckling. Tja, Linux har redan lagt grunden för att anpassas till olika behov.
      När det gäller bärbara datorer i Kina har de många begränsningar, så som många av oss vet har de även sina egna sociala nätverk.

  4.   Rubén sade

    Enligt min ödmjuka åsikt som användare som har testat Linux-distributioner i många år måste jag säga att det grundläggande problemet är att det inte finns någon enhet i Linux och att varje distribution får sina buts, vilket inte händer med Windows eftersom alla potentiella mänskliga är dedikerade till ett enda operativsystem, varför detta är det mest polerade. Förhoppningsvis kommer dagen när vi har en enda Linux-distribution som stöds av den enorma gruppen och vi alla kan njuta av ett operativsystem på höjden och utan buts ... Även om jag varje år har observerat stora förändringar i de olika distributionerna, erkänner jag att buts håller mig igång med Windows, och sanningen är att jag inte vill, men jag tvingas göra det.

    1.    Rodrigo Mariano Villar Vespa sade

      "Linux har utan tvekan nått poäng som andra knappt kunde uppnå, så är fallet i servrar eftersom det praktiskt taget dominerar marknaden."

      PS4 använder Orbis OS som är baserat på FreeBSD, Nintendo Switch använder också ett operativsystem baserat på FreeBSD, Apples operativsystem är BSD OS och deras marknadsandel är ganska stor för att inte tala om att NetBSD, OpenBSD och FreeBSD också används i stor utsträckning, OpenBSD är används när bäst säkerhet krävs, kan NetBSD på grund av sin bärbarhet användas i nästan vilken enhet som helst som stöder 58 hårdvaruarkitekturer som används av NASA och FreeBSD till exempel används av Netflix och WhatsApp bland många, sägs det att över 40% av alla internet körs på FreeBSD.

  5.   Ljusskapare sade

    Enligt min mening är detta en utmärkt analys. ?

    1.    AvFenix sade

      Använd BSD eftersom dess licens tillåter dig att starta från operativsystemet med öppen och fri källa, göra ändringar i den och sedan konvertera den modifieringen till egen programvara. Därför är det så populärt bland många företag att använda BSD i några av dess varianter. Sony använder det också för PS4 och kommer att fortsätta att göra det med PS5.

      När det gäller fragmenteringen av Linux är det något som inte går att återställa. Även om fragmenteringen inte finns i GNU / Linux, utan snarare biblioteken med vilka skrivbord och applikationer för dem utvecklas. Det finns i grunden ett slags splittring inom Linux-världen med uppdelningen mellan GTK och Qt. Stora företag har valt Gnome och GTK, även om en stor andel vanliga användare har en preferens för KDE Plasma, som fungerar med Qt. Denna fragmentering kommer inte att sluta, av GNU / Linux-karaktären, där användaren tenderar att söka maximal frihet i möjligheten att välja mellan många alternativ, och utvecklare tenderar att göra gafflar för att fånga sin egen vision om hur de har. att vara en app.

      Jag ser dock inte fragmentering som det stora hindret för att Linux exploderar på skrivbordet. Anledningen till att inte starta är hos hårdvarutillverkarna, främst datorer som redan säljer maskinen med Windows förinstallerat. Om de kom överens om och fortsatte att sälja datorerna med Linux förinstallerat, skulle det dröja några år innan Linux skulle bli skrivbordsstandarden till nackdel för Windows. Den stora massan av användare installerar inte operativsystemet, de köper helt enkelt datorn med det redan installerade systemet. Precis som Android inte är installerat, men du köper helt enkelt en terminal och den levereras redan med Android såvida du inte köper en iPhone. Helt enkelt för att terminaltillverkare redan väljer att använda Android på ett generaliserat sätt. Om datorn gjorde samma sak med Linux, skulle folk massivt använda Linux på skrivbordet.

  6.   Rodrigo Mariano Villar Vespa sade

    GNU / Linux som jag gillade tidigare. Varför inte nu? Det finns flera anledningar bland dem GNU / Linux är kombinationen av GNU och Linux som bildar ett enda operativsystem vilket gör att det är flera stycken tillsammans för att bilda ett operativsystem är mycket rörigt jämfört med OpenBSD, NetBSD och FreeBSD (De 3 huvudsakliga BSD: erna) de är kompletta operativsystem och det verkar något utan att sitta ner men att något är välstrukturerat, ordnat, har konsistens såväl som att det inte är två projekt som inte har samma mål, då finns det beroendeproblem som genereras till exempel Med RPM-paket, trots att det är samma paket, finns det beroendeproblem, för att inte tala om att det finns ett absurt stort antal distributioner som flera liknar varandra och inte ger en jävla förutom den löjliga och absurda tanken att allt är enkelt och enkel att använda genererar fragmentering och naturligtvis i GNU / Linux är det vanligt att se någon som vill uppfinna allt som Systemd som är en mycket motbjudande kräk med skit Ovan finns det naturligtvis flera init-system men det är ett av många GNU / Linux-problem, det finns ingen standard men alla går dit de vill.

    Slutligen, nej, det är inte skräppost, jag nämner bara flera skäl till varför GNU / Linux inte gillar mig och det misslyckas på skrivbordet främst på grund av det stora antalet distributioner, jämfört med BSD, den senare är rivaler med GNU / Linux och även om många inte är intresserade av de mycket tekniska aspekterna vet att dessa påverkar operativsystemets beteende där GNU / Linux har enorma brister och defekter jämfört med BSD som skulle vara tillsammans med GNU / Linux den mest avancerade Unix-Like.

  7.   marc sade

    Vi arbetar som vanligt och jämför ett företag som är koloss tack vare försäljning och återförsäljning av samma operativsystem, med Linux som är ett samarbetsprojekt, det har ingen jämförelse, de är väldigt olika saker, om du inte gillar det, använd inte Linux, om du är lite värdelös för att ta reda på vad du använder, använd inte Linux, det är så enkelt som det är.
    Jag skulle säga till Tobias att oroa sig lite mer för Gnome, att även om det verkar som om det är det fantastiska alternativet det inte är, så är dokumentationen Fuzzy på sidan, du vet inte exakt om det du läser fortfarande är i kraft eller har blivit föråldrat , arkitekturen Gnome är en annan otydlig punkt och för att komplettera det är komplexiteten att skapa användargränssnitt i Gnome med paket som Glib utan att använda RAS-gränssnitt är hög om inte särskilt hög, något som du backar när du vill justera lite applikationskod .
    På sidan av "appbutiker" tror jag inte heller, du har AppImage ett STOR applikationsgalleri, från flatpak och snap finns det också programvaruförråd av allt som en utvecklare vågar docka, och om det inte räcker , Det finns också ett stort arkiv med applikationer som använder Electron, så berätta inte för mig att det inte finns några förråd och allt detta utan att räkna förvaret för var och en av distroerna som är oändligt enklare att installera än till exempel en spricka för något program av WinX som du inte vill betala en bra nypa pengar.
    Det verkar verkligen som om det finns tillräckligt med alternativ för var och en av de saker som Tobias ber om, och lyckligtvis finns det mycket bra alternativ.

  8.   Isaac Palace sade

    Varför sveper WhatsApp över Telegram och är det andra tekniskt överlägsna? Av samma anledning att Windows fortfarande är kung på skrivbordet.